I've been a huge fan of classic literature for years, and 'Pride and Prejudice' is one of my all-time favorites. You can absolutely download it in PDF format from Project Gutenberg. They offer free access to public domain books, and Austen's masterpiece is definitely available there. The process is super simple—just head to their website, search for the title, and choose the PDF option among the download formats. I've done this myself multiple times when I wanted to reread it on my tablet. The quality is great, and it preserves all the original charm of the story. It's a fantastic way to enjoy this timeless romance without spending a dime.

Are There Any Adaptations Of Gutenberg Pride And Prejudice?

3 Answers2025-07-11 02:26:47
I’ve been obsessed with 'Pride and Prejudice' for years, and yes, there are SO many adaptations! The most iconic one is the 1995 BBC miniseries with Colin Firth as Mr. Darcy—that lake scene lives in my head rent-free. There’s also the 2005 movie starring Keira Knightley, which is gorgeous but cuts a lot of the book’s details. For something quirky, 'Pride and Prejudice and Zombies' is a wild mashup of classic romance and horror. If you’re into modern twists, 'Bride and Prejudice' is a Bollywood musical version that’s super fun. And let’s not forget the web series 'The Lizzie Bennet Diaries,' which reimagines the story as a vlog—it’s surprisingly heartfelt!

Does Gutenberg Pride And Prejudice Include Illustrations?

3 Answers2025-07-11 08:37:38
I've been collecting vintage editions of classic novels for years, and 'Pride and Prejudice' is one of my favorites. The original Gutenberg version, being a plain text project, doesn't include any illustrations. It's purely the raw, beautiful text of Jane Austen's masterpiece. Some later print editions might have illustrations, but the Gutenberg file is all about preserving the words exactly as Austen wrote them. If you want illustrations, you'd need to look for special illustrated editions from publishers like Penguin Classics or Folio Society, which often include period-accurate artwork or modern interpretations of the scenes.

What Formats Does Project Gutenberg Provide For Pride And Prejudice?

4 Answers2025-07-12 23:30:30
As someone who frequently dives into classic literature, I can tell you that Project Gutenberg offers 'Pride and Prejudice' in a variety of formats to suit different reading preferences. You can find the novel in plain text, which is perfect for quick reading or copying quotes. For those who enjoy a more structured layout, HTML format is available, making it easy to read on browsers. If you prefer e-readers, options like EPUB and Kindle formats are also provided, ensuring compatibility with devices like Kindle, Nook, or Kobo. For audiobook lovers, there’s even a version in MP3 format, though it’s often a volunteer-read narration rather than a professional recording. The MOBI format is another great choice for older Kindle devices. Each format preserves the charm of Austen’s prose, so you can enjoy Elizabeth and Darcy’s story just the way you like it.
